Hi,

This is my first time to put up an item and I seem to have inadvertently 'closed' the Thread on a posting that I added yesterday. What does this mean now? Does it mean that no one can post an interest in my article?. Can this 'closed' thread be undone or do I need to put up a new post for my article?

Hi phyl,

To Open/Close an ad, click on "Thread Tools" at the top right of your ad (above the date). Choose the relevant option from the dropdown box and then click "Perform Action" at the bottom of the dropdown box.

Even if a thread or ad is closed/locked, Members can still send you PMs (Private Messages) by clicking on your User Name. However, public posts can't be made on closed/locked ads/threads.
